ROLE

We are passionate about data. We collaborate to build elegant, effective, scalable and highly reliable solutions to empower predictive modelling in finance.

Cubist’s Data Services (CDS) group is looking for a Data Scientist to join our dedicated data team. Our group is responsible for the timely delivery of comprehensive and error-free data to some of the most demanding and successful systematic Portfolio Managers in the world.

As a Senior Data Scientist in the team, this individual will play a vital role in ensuring the smooth day-to-day implementation of a large research infrastructure, and the live production trading of billions of dollars of capital across global capital markets, including equities, futures, options and other financial instruments. 

RESPONSIBILITIES 

  • Onboarding novel datasets from a huge variety of sources into our platform
  • Building processes, tools and frameworks to ingest, clean and deliver datasets
  • Analysis of data for usability, cleanliness, feature extraction and proposed usage by investment teams
  • Creation of in-house, value added, derived data products for consumption by investment teams
  • Engaging with vendors and internal stakeholders to understand characteristics of datasets
  • Partnering closely with investment teams to ensure their data requirements are met
  • Research on new technologies (including AI solutions) to continuously improve data management and value-add for investment teams

REQUIREMENTS 

  • PhD or Masters in Financial Engineering, Statistics, Computer Science or other disciplines involving rigorous quantitative analysis
  • Strong programming skills in Python and SQL
  • Experience working with AWS, Linux and Airflow preferred but not required
  • 5+ years of experience as a Data Scientist or similar role
  • Experience working with large data sets including predictive modeling
  • Financial industry experience preferred but not required
  • Strong organization, communication and interpersonal skills
  • Intellectual curiosity and enthusiasm for learning
  • Attention to detail and a love of processes
  • Strong oral and written communication skills
  • Ability to multitask and prioritize assignments
  • Commitment to the highest ethical standards

What you need to know about the Singapore Tech Scene

The digital revolution has driven a constant demand for tech professionals across industries like software development, data analytics and cybersecurity. In Singapore, one of the largest cities in Southeast Asia, the demand for tech talent is so high that the government continues to invest millions into programs designed to develop a talent pipeline directly from universities while also scaling efforts in pre-employment training and mid-career upskilling to expand and elevate its workforce.
